Problems We Diagnose and Fix

HVAC Problems MBM Diagnoses and Repairs in Deenwood, GA

System Not Heating or Cooling at All in Deenwood

Complete failure to heat or cool is the most urgent HVAC symptom with the broadest range of possible causes in Deenwood, GA. On the cooling side: failed compressor, refrigerant leak, failed condenser fan, or electrical fault preventing outdoor unit startup in Deenwood. On the heating side: failed igniter, failed flame sensor, cracked heat exchanger, gas valve fault, or heat pump reversing valve issue in Deenwood, GA.

HVAC Running Continuously Without Reaching Setpoint in Deenwood, GA

A system that runs but fails to reach the thermostat setpoint has a capacity or efficiency problem in Deenwood. Low refrigerant reducing cooling or heating capacity. Dirty condenser coils reducing efficiency. Contaminated heat exchanger. Or duct system leakage delivering conditioned air to unconditioned spaces in Deenwood, GA.

Short Cycling — Turning On and Off Too Frequently in Deenwood

Short cycling produces wear on every major HVAC component at an accelerated rate because startup is the most stressful moment in any component's operating cycle in Deenwood, GA. A failing capacitor. A high-limit switch tripping from restricted airflow. An incorrect refrigerant charge. Or an oversized system satisfying the thermostat before completing a full conditioning cycle in Deenwood.

Unusual Noises From Any Part of the HVAC System in Deenwood, GA

Every HVAC sound maps to a specific developing fault in Deenwood. Grinding or squealing from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Deenwood, GA. Banging or booming at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Deenwood. Rattling from the outdoor unit indicates debris or a loose component in Deenwood, GA. Hissing or bubbling indicates refrigerant escaping through a leak in Deenwood.

HVAC Tripping Circuit Breakers or Blowing Fuses in Deenwood

An HVAC system that consistently trips its circuit breaker is drawing more current than the circuit is rated for in Deenwood, GA. A failing compressor drawing locked rotor current at startup. A failing blower motor drawing excessive current. A capacitor fault causing motors to draw excessive starting current. Or a short circuit in the electrical wiring or control system in Deenwood.

Uneven Temperatures Throughout the Home in Deenwood, GA

Rooms consistently hotter or colder than others despite consistent thermostat settings have a distribution problem in Deenwood. Duct leakage or damage reducing conditioned air delivery to specific zones. Blocked or restricted supply registers in affected rooms. A blower operating at reduced capacity from contamination. Or zoning system faults in Deenwood, GA.

Higher Than Expected Energy Bills From the HVAC in Deenwood

An HVAC consuming more energy than it should for the conditioning it produces has a specific efficiency problem in Deenwood, GA. Contaminated blower wheel reducing airflow. Dirty condenser coils reducing heat rejection. Low refrigerant reducing system efficiency. Or duct leakage in Deenwood.

How a Single Fault Creates Secondary Stress on Adjacent Components in Deenwood, GA

A failing capacitor causes the compressor to draw locked rotor current at startup, heating the compressor motor windings and accelerating insulation breakdown in Deenwood. If the capacitor is not replaced, the compressor continues this abnormal startup pattern and eventually fails from the accumulated thermal stress in Deenwood, GA. A failed condenser fan causes the condenser coil to overheat, raising head pressure in the refrigerant circuit and stressing the compressor in Deenwood. In each case, the initial component failure creates conditions that produce secondary failure if the initial fault is not corrected promptly in Deenwood, GA.

What Professional Diagnostic Equipment Identifies in Deenwood, GA

Refrigerant gauges measure the suction and discharge pressure in the refrigerant circuit, revealing refrigerant charge level and compressor performance in Deenwood. Electrical meters measure voltage, amperage, and resistance at every electrical component, identifying failing capacitors, contactors, and motor windings in Deenwood, GA. Combustion analyzers confirm complete combustion and identify heat exchanger faults in Deenwood. Airflow meters measure supply and return airflow, identifying duct, coil, and blower performance issues in Deenwood, GA.

Yes. A failing capacitor causes compressor and condenser fan motors to draw excessive startup current and experience thermal stress that accelerates their deterioration in Deenwood. Low refrigerant causes the compressor to operate with insufficient oil circulation, accelerating compressor wear in Deenwood, GA. Addressing the originating fault promptly prevents secondary component damage in Deenwood.
A consistently tripping HVAC circuit breaker indicates the system is drawing more current than the circuit is rated for in Deenwood. The most common causes are a failing compressor drawing locked rotor current at startup, a failing blower motor drawing excessive current, a capacitor fault causing motors to draw excessive starting current, and short circuits in the electrical wiring or control system in Deenwood, GA.
